Bluetooth
Bluetooth is a short-range wireless communications
technology capable of exchanging information over a
distance of about 30 feet without requiring a physical
connection.
Unlike infrared, you don't need to line up the devices
to beam information with Bluetooth. If the devices are
within a range of one another, you can exchange
information between them, even if they are located in
different rooms.
The Bluetooth wireless technology settings menu
provides the ability to view and change the device
name, show the visibility, and set the security for the
device.
Turn Bluetooth On/Off
When the Bluetooth is turned on, you can use the
Bluetooth features available. When the Bluetooth is
turned off, you cannot send or receive information via
Bluetooth. To save battery life or in situations where
Bluetooth use is prohibited, such as airline traveling,
you can turn off the Bluetooth wireless technology
headset.
